Lightening Capability

Choosing the right hair bleach involves understanding its lightening capability, which can greatly impact your results. Most hair bleaches can lift color between 5 to 9 levels, depending on the formulation and developer used. If you’re aiming for a dramatic change, higher volume developers (30 or 40) can provide greater lifting power but come with an increased risk of damage. On the other hand, a 20 volume developer offers a gentler lift. Keep in mind that darker hair often needs more potent formulations or longer processing times. Additionally, some bleaches help neutralize warm tones to prevent brassiness. Finally, always monitor processing time carefully to avoid over-processing and damaging your hair.

Hair Type Compatibility

Understanding how your hair type interacts with bleach is vital for achieving the best results while minimizing damage. If you have fine hair, opt for gentler formulations, as it’s more susceptible to breakage. For color-treated or previously bleached hair, look for products designed to reduce damage while still lifting color effectively. Curly or coily textures often need bleach with moisturizing ingredients to combat dryness. Evaluating your hair’s porosity is also essential; highly porous hair may lift faster but can sustain more damage. Finally, consider your natural color: darker hair generally requires more lift and possibly multiple applications. By aligning your bleach choice with your hair type, you’ll set yourself up for a successful transformation.

Application Method

Finding the right application method for hair bleach can make a significant difference in your bleaching experience. I usually consider whether I prefer a powder or cream bleach; powder lighteners need mixing with a developer and can create a mess, while cream formulations are easier to apply. It’s also crucial to evaluate the tools included—like brushes and gloves—because they can simplify the process. If you’re worried about dust, opt for dust-free formulas to minimize inhalation. Pay attention to the recommended developer volumes, as they affect how much lift you’ll achieve. Finally, verify the product provides clear application instructions, especially if you’re a beginner, to help you achieve even coverage and fantastic results.

What Should I Do if My Hair Turns Orange After Bleaching?

If my hair turns orange after bleaching, I don’t panic. First, I assess the damage and wait a day or two to let my hair settle. Then, I use a purple shampoo to neutralize the warmth. If that doesn’t work, I might try a toner specifically designed for orange tones. Sometimes, a second bleaching session is necessary, but I always prioritize my hair’s health. Patience is key, and I won’t rush the process!
